Representatives from the Eurasian Economic Commission (EEC) and the Ministry of Energy of Russia have agreed to set up an expert group with respect to creating a single stock exchange space within the energy sector of the Eurasian Economic Union (EAEU).   

Press service of the EEC, which is the executive body of the EAEU, informed the aforementioned.

During a working meeting, the Member of the Board - Minister in charge of Energy and Infrastructure of the EEC, Danil Ibrayev, and the Russian Minister of Energy, Alexander Novak, discussed topical matters in the energy sector

EAEU comprises Armenia, Russia, Belarus, Kazakhstan, and Kyrgyzstan.
